Before filling out the KVS Admission Form 2026-27, parents should keep all the required documents ready. Uploading clear and valid documents helps ensure a smooth verification process and reduces the chances of application rejection. Depending on the class and category, additional documents may also be required during admission verification.

List of Documents Required
DocumentPurposeBirth CertificateProof of the child's date of birthPassport-size PhotographRecent passport-size photo of the childAadhaar CardAadhaar of the child (if available)Residence ProofAddress verification (Electricity Bill, Aadhaar, Voter ID, Passport, etc.)Parent's Identity ProofAadhaar Card, PAN Card, Passport, or Voter IDSC/ST/OBC-NCL CertificateRequired for reserved category applicantsEWS/BPL CertificateRequired for EWS or BPL category applicantsDisability CertificateFor Children with Special Needs (CwSN/PwD)Service CertificateFor children of Central/State Government employees or PSU employeesTransfer DetailsService transfer certificate (if applicable)Previous School Report CardRequired for Class 2 and above admissionsBlood Group Certificate (if available)May be requested by some Kendriya Vidyalayas
Important Tips for Document Upload
- Upload only clear and readable scanned copies.
- Ensure that the child's name and date of birth match across all documents.
- Keep both original documents and photocopies ready for physical verification.
- Incorrect or fake documents may result in cancellation of admission.
- Reserved category applicants must upload valid certificates issued by the competent authority.
How to Fill the KVS Admission Form 2026-27 Online?
The online application process for Balvatika and Class 1 admissions is simple and user-friendly. Parents can complete the registration through the official KVS Admission Portal by following the steps below.
Step 1: Visit the Official Admission Portal
Open the official KVS admission website and click on "Register" to begin the application process.
Step 2: Create a Registration Account
Enter the following details:
- Parent/Guardian Name
- Mobile Number
- Email Address
- OTP Verification
After successful verification, a unique Login Code will be generated.
Step 3: Login to Your Account
Use the Login Code and registered mobile number/email ID to access the application dashboard.
Step 4: Fill Child's Personal Details
Provide accurate information such as:
- Child's Name
- Date of Birth
- Gender
- Aadhaar Number (if available)
- Nationality
- Parent Details
- Residential Address
Ensure that all details match the supporting documents.
Step 5: Select Preferred Kendriya Vidyalayas
Choose your preferred Kendriya Vidyalayas in order of preference. Selecting multiple schools can improve the chances of admission, depending on seat availability.
Step 6: Upload Required Documents
Upload scanned copies of the required documents in the prescribed format and file size.
Step 7: Preview the Application
Carefully review all entered details before submission. Make corrections, if necessary.
Step 8: Submit the Application
After verifying all information, click "Submit".
A unique Application Submission Code will be generated.
Step 9: Download the Confirmation Page
Download and print the submitted application form for future reference and document verification.
Class-wise KVS Admission Process 2026-27
The admission process differs depending on the class for which you are applying.
Balvatika I, II & III Admission
- Admission is conducted through the online registration portal.
- Eligible children must satisfy the prescribed age criteria.
- Selection is made through a computerized lottery system if applications exceed the available seats.
- Available only in selected Kendriya Vidyalayas.
Class 1 Admission
Class 1 is the main entry point into Kendriya Vidyalayas.
Admission Process:
- Online Registration
- Document Verification
- Computerized Lottery
- Publication of Selection List
- Fee Submission
- Final Admission Confirmation
No entrance examination is conducted for Class 1 admissions.
Class 2 to Class 8 Admission
Admissions for Classes 2 to 8 are conducted only if vacancies are available.
The process generally includes:
- Offline application at the respective Kendriya Vidyalaya.
- Verification of documents.
- Preparation of the admission list based on seat availability and KVS guidelines.
No admission test is conducted for these classes.
Class 9 Admission
Admission to Class 9 is subject to vacant seats.
The process may include:
- Registration
- Document Verification
- Admission Test (where applicable)
- Merit List
- Final Admission
Class 11 Admission
Admission to Class 11 is based on the student's performance in the Class 10 Board Examination and the availability of seats in the chosen stream (Science, Commerce, or Humanities).
Students from Kendriya Vidyalayas are generally given priority before considering applicants from other schools.
KVS Admission Lottery System 2026
One of the most frequently asked questions by parents is how students are selected for admission in Kendriya Vidyalayas.
The KVS admission process for Balvatika and Class 1 is based on a computerized lottery system, ensuring complete transparency and fairness. If the number of applications exceeds the available seats, a digital draw of lots is conducted according to the reservation policy and admission priority categories.
How Does the Lottery System Work?
- Online registrations are accepted within the official admission schedule.
- Applications are categorized according to reservation and priority categories.
- A computerized lottery is conducted when applications exceed the available seats.
- The first provisional selection list is published on the official KVS admission portal and the respective school's notice board.
- If seats remain vacant, second and third selection lists are released.
- Selected candidates must complete document verification and admission formalities before the deadline.
Key Features of the Lottery System
- No entrance examination is conducted.
- Selection is completely computerized and transparent.
- Reservation rules are applied during the lottery process.
- Waitlisted candidates may receive admission if selected students do not complete the admission process.
- Final admission is confirmed only after successful document verification.
Important Note
Receiving an Application Submission Code does not guarantee admission. Admission is confirmed only if the child's name appears in the official selection list and all required documents are successfully verified.
